    Abstract

    The recent technological growth in the field of video communications has caused a rise of video applications along with an emergence of new large screen mobile devices. Note that unlike the second and the third generation wireless technologies, the Long-Term Evolution (LTE) is able to support high data rate video applications based on its increased capacity. A Cross-Layer Adaptation (CLA) approach has become very popular due to its ability to achieve an acceptable video quality and satisfy delay requirements over the error-prone LTE networks. The CLA design implies the interaction between the network layers that results in adaptation of the source compression and channel coding toward an optimized video delivery. This paper presents a survey on the recent CLA advances which claim to provide considerable improvements for video communication over LTE. State-of-the-art CLA techniques are studied based on the type of adaptation, distortion estimation and optimization problem formulation and solution.
